Can I charge my iPod (Mac version) with a PC, using a 6 pin firewire cable? Obviously, there's nothing to sync with, but from time to time, I'd like to charge my 'Pod at work, where I use a peecee (ugh!)

Yes. I do it all the time. I have MacDrive on my PC so I can actually access the data -- but it will charge even if it's unreadable to the Pee Cee.
